Theoretical issues of sustainable rural settlements development formation
Nowadays sustainable rural development is a priority tendency of their socioeconomicdevelopment. Research of sustainable rural settlements development concept is carried out using different approaches. Ecologicaland socio-economic aspects are considered. Researchers-ecologists accentuate the ecological point of view. They connect sustainabledevelopment with human beings survival because of escalated environmental problems. This approach is also common forforeign researchers. To achieve a sustainable rural development they offer to run eco-economy: production of organic food and renewablesources of energy, as well as eco-tourism development. The second point of view is typical for states that have serious socioeconomicproblems in rural settlements, including the Russian Federation. On the one hand, socio-economic rural settlements developmentis regarded as the main element of sustainable development, on the other hand, as an important factor that determines sustainablerural settlements development. There are different points of view on sustainable development in this approach. Some researchers (representativesof the Centre of Sustainable Development of Rural Areas in Moscow, Agricultural Academy named after K.A. Temirazev)use an integrated approach to the concept of sustainable development: they consider both ecological and socio-economical aspects of it.They pay great attention to diversification of activity in rural areas: both in rural and timber development, trade, industry, production ofconstructions, tourism and services development. Sustainable rural settlements development should be based on self-sufficiency of ruralsettlements and active participation of local initiatives. The other approach to the problem of sustainable rural development characterizesthe representatives of the Institute of Agrarian Problems, Russian Academy of Science. They connect sustainable rural developmentwith socio-economic development of agro-food production. In other words, sustainable rural settlements development is determined bythe efficiency of agro-food producers activity. Important work in the field of sustainable rural settlements development belongs toI.N.Buzdalov. In his opinion, among the most important conditions of sustainable development (economic, social and ecological) themain is the economic condition, as the production development transformation of social sphere and environment protection depend of it.On the base of the proposed socio-economic approaches, the author has highlighted the components of sustainable rural settlementsdevelopment and specified its conception.
